Born in Tennessee and raised in Ohio, Scott Russell Sanders studied at Brown University and earned his doctorate from the University of Cambridge as a Marshall Scholar. He spent his career as an English professor at Indiana University and is the author of 20 books, including Staying Put, Writing from the Center, Hunting for Hope and A Private History of Awe which was nominated for a Pulitzer Prize. His most recent book is A Conservationist Manifesto, in which, according to Booklist, “Sanders views preserving wilderness as a Sabbath in space instead of in time. People who practice an ‘ethic of restraint’ are ark builders because their simpler ways of living are ‘vessels’ holding the wisdom we need to survive the ‘rising flood’ of environmental concerns.”
